It was announced today that The Toys That Made Us will be coming back for two new seasons beginning next year. Creator Brian Volk-weiss took to Instagram with the good news, confirming that Seasons 5 and 6 of the docuseries are on the way - with a total of 8 new episodes slated for 2025 and 2026.

The show premiered in 2017, airing three seasons through 2019 when it was thought to have ended. Today's announcement will surely please fans of vintage toys, as a new batch of old favorites will now get to see the spotlight.

The show takes a deep dive into the origins of history's most iconic and impactful toy franchises. Some had meteoric rises, some had big falls, but all of these billion-dollar creations were important to legions of children. Some of the toy lines covered include Transformers, Star Wars, G.I. Joe, LEGO, My Little Pony, Power Rangers, and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les.
